I'm getting ready to put new pads on the front of my 84. Besides OEM, I see Hawk has a set at a reasonable price. I'm not looking for race quality, just best all-purpose. Any recommendations?
Also, I think stopping requires more pedal pressure than I'm used to. There's no fade or mushiness. How do you know if the brake assist needs replacement? Fluid levels are fine.

i went to the local auto supply and picked up pads. no real preference as long as they stop the car
. ceramic pads my require more pressure so i have been told. have you bled the brakes? also what happened to me is that the back brake calipers were not working and got lucky and freed them up. see if you can feel if all the brakes are working when you stop. usually if the fronts are working the front of car will dip when you step on brake. it may be easier to have someone watch the rears on gravel to see if tires are stopping unless you can feel it while driving it.

I used Performance Friction Carbon metallic on all of my cars, including my '84 Vette. They are awesome. Superior stopping power and no fade. I bought them at AutoZone a few years ago.
